New to Community? Here are 3 Steps to Get Started

 

Hello beautiful people! Although many of you are familiar with the Beauty Insider Community – aka the BIC - we wanted to give some tips on how to navigate if you are new around here!

 

If you are new, first of all, we want to welcome you to Sephora’s Beauty Insider Community, your one-stop destination to share beauty advice, inspiration, news, and recommendations with real people in real time. We want you to feel comfortable in the BIC, so in the video above, Team BIC members @KatieBT and @BrendaBT outline the first 3 basic steps to get started.

 

Step 1:

First step, let’s work on your Profile! Pick a user name, add a photo, and tell us more about you!

 

Step 2:

Join groups! Head to the Groups page to browse and join different groups that speak to you and find conversations based on your beauty interests.

 

Step 3:

Introduce yourself in our latest New Member Monday thread, which we feature  the first Monday of every month! Need a little help figuring out how to post a reply or start a new thread in Community? No problem - check out our thread How to Post in Community thread and video.

 

This Community is a place for friendly discussion, questions, photo sharing, product recommendations, sharing experiences, and connecting with other beauty lovers like yourself – whether you’re a pro or a newbie, or somewhere in between.

 

We’re so excited you’re here! If you ever have any questions, do not hesitate to ask -- this community LOVES to help.

I think a solid starting routine is wash, moisturize and spf and you can expand from there ‌😁

 

What are you're skin concerns? If you know what you want from your routine it is easier to build. Target fine lines, texture, drynes, redness etc..

 

 

For make up, starting with mascara, a tinted lip balm and and a neutral eye shadow palette is a great start to get your toes back in the water and see what you like ‌😁‌ 

 

#ONE/SIZE by Patrick Starrr PATRICK STARRR Visionary Eyeshadow Palette 15 x 0.05 oz for example, is on sale right now , and has a lot of colours to play with that are everyday wearable. 

 

Starting with a mini size in mascara is a less expensive way to try new things, i like #MILK MAKEUP Mini KUSH High Volumizing Mascara 0.13 oz/ 4 mL for its fluffy brush 😁
